6. F. orientalis L. View in CoL , Sp. Pl. 247 (1753) View Cited Treatment .
Stem 80-150 cm. Leaves 4-pinnate; lobes c. 5 mm, narrowly linear. Leaf-bases welldeveloped and sheathing. Umbels with c. 10 rays; partial umbels with 10-15 flowers. Fruit c. 10 mm. Dry grassland. S. Ukraine; one station in S.E. Bulgaria. Bu Rs (W, K).
